    Cancel Personal Settings

    Please help if you know the answer. I've searched and asked colleagues but nobody has a satisfactory answer.

    My office has many XP computers and users. Maintenance has become a nightmare because Users' login info occasionally gets contaminated or our IT tech messes something up. Re-mapping access to drives and folders seems to be a daily chore now. If desktops and settings were the same for everybody - Administrators and Users alike - life would be much easier.

    How do I CANCEL personal settings and keep the desktop and Users' and Administrator's desktops (but not Permissions or Passwords) the same?

    Re: Cancel Personal Settings

    I dont think that it is possible to have same desktop on different user profiles or user accounts, because if it was possible then what was the use of the concept of multi user account? What you can do is log into admin account on each pc and modify ownership and permissions of folders and files as per your needs, so that users cant modify it later.
